1 What to Look for in a BIM Service Provider

🔍 LOD capability · Multi-discipline coordination · Clash detection · Digital twin

BIM services span an enormous capability range — from firms producing basic 3D Revit models with no coordination value to genuine multi-discipline BIM managers delivering LOD 500 as-built digital twins with integrated facility management data. The distinction matters: poor BIM execution generates rework, clash-driven construction delays, and handover failures. World-class BIM delivery eliminates field conflicts, compresses construction timelines, and produces facility management assets that serve owners for decades.

Critical evaluation criteria for BIM service providers

  • LOD capability: Demonstrated ability to deliver LOD 300 design coordination through LOD 400 construction documentation and LOD 500 as-built models — with evidence, not claims
  • Multi-discipline integration: Architectural, structural, MEP (mechanical, electrical, plumbing) coordination in a single federated model — not siloed discipline models that never get combined
  • Clash detection and resolution: Active Navisworks or Solibri clash detection with documented resolution workflows, not passive model federation
  • BIM Execution Plan (BEP) capability: Ability to author and deliver against a project-specific BIM Execution Plan — a non-negotiable for international clients and government mandates
  • Construction phase BIM: 4D (schedule) and 5D (cost/quantity take-off) integration, not just design-phase modelling
  • CDE (Common Data Environment) management: Experience with ACC (Autodesk Construction Cloud), Trimble Connect, BIM 360, or equivalent platforms
  • Digital twin and FM handover: Ability to produce COBie-compliant or IFC-native as-built models linked to CAFM/IWMS systems
  • Sector depth: Proven track record in your specific sector — data centers, healthcare, commercial, infrastructure — not generic portfolio claims
  • ISO 19650 compliance: Understanding of the international BIM information management standard increasingly required for export-market and government projects

4 Understanding LOD Levels and What to Demand

🏆 LOD 100–500 explained · Project phase alignment · Owner requirements

LOD (Level of Development) defines the precision and reliability of information in a BIM model at each project phase. Specifying the correct LOD requirements — and verifying that your provider can actually deliver them — is the most important technical decision in BIM procurement.

LOD levels and their project phase application

  • LOD 100 — Conceptual: Massing and area information only. Suitable for feasibility studies and concept approvals. No reliable geometry for coordination.
  • LOD 200 — Schematic: Approximate geometry with systems represented generically. Suitable for design development and early coordination checks.
  • LOD 300 — Design Documentation: Specific geometry, size, shape, location, and orientation. Suitable for coordination, permit applications, and contractor tendering. The minimum for meaningful clash detection.
  • LOD 350 — Construction Coordination: Elements show interfaces with adjacent elements. Required for detailed MEP coordination and shop drawing production. Critical for prefabrication decisions.
  • LOD 400 — Fabrication Ready: Full fabrication, assembly, and installation detail. Required for off-site prefabrication and precise installation sequencing.
  • LOD 500 — As-Built (Record): Verified in-place geometry and data. The basis for digital twin and facility management systems. Requires post-construction survey verification.

Critical due diligence questions for any BIM provider

  • Can you provide 3 project references where LOD 350+ was delivered, with documented clash counts resolved before construction?
  • Who authors your BIM Execution Plans and what templates do you use?
  • Which CDE platform do you use and how do you manage model versioning and issue control?
  • What is your process for coordinating structural and MEP models — who manages federation and clash workflows?
  • How do you deliver as-built models — what survey/verification process ensures LOD 500 accuracy?
  • What formats do you deliver for FM handover — COBie, IFC, native Revit, or linked to a specific CAFM platform?
  • Are your BIM managers accredited — Autodesk Certified Professional, RICS BIM, or equivalent?

Is BIM mandatory for construction projects in India?
Yes — for central government projects. The Government of India mandated BIM adoption for all centrally funded construction projects above ₹100 crore from 2019 onwards, with phased expansion. Several state governments have followed with their own mandates. Private sector adoption is accelerating independently, driven by international operators (hyperscale cloud providers, global real estate developers) who require BIM as a contract condition, and by contractors who have discovered that BIM-coordinated projects run faster with fewer RFIs and change orders. BIM mandates are expanding, not retreating.
What is the difference between a BIM service provider and a CAD/drafting firm?
A genuine BIM service provider creates and manages intelligent, coordinated, data-rich building models that serve as single sources of truth throughout design, construction, and operations. A CAD or drafting firm produces 2D drawings or basic 3D geometry without coordination value, clash detection, or information management capability. The critical differentiators are: active clash detection workflows (finding and resolving hundreds of conflicts before construction), 4D/5D integration, BIM Execution Plan authorship, CDE management, and as-built digital twin delivery. Many firms have renamed themselves as "BIM providers" while continuing to produce essentially CAD outputs — always verify with project references and demand to see clash detection reports.
What LOD should I specify in my BIM contract?
At minimum, require LOD 300 for design coordination and permit submissions. For any project with complex MEP systems (data centers, hospitals, commercial towers), require LOD 350 for coordination and LOD 400 for MEP services. If you want a useful facility management model at handover, specify LOD 500 as-built with COBie or IFC delivery and define which asset attributes must be populated (manufacturer, model number, warranty dates, maintenance schedules). Specify LOD requirements by discipline — architectural may be LOD 300, structural LOD 350, MEP LOD 400 — and require the provider to confirm these in the BIM Execution Plan before contract award.
What BIM software do top providers in India use?
The dominant platform is Autodesk Revit for architectural, structural, and MEP building BIM, with Navisworks for multi-discipline federation and clash detection. Autodesk Construction Cloud (ACC) / BIM 360 is the leading CDE platform. Infrastructure specialists use Autodesk Civil 3D, Bentley OpenRoads/OpenBridge, or MicroStation. Process plant specialists use AVEVA PDMS/E3D or Intergraph SmartPlant. For digital twin and FM integration, Bentley iTwin, Autodesk Tandem, and open IFC/COBie formats are used. Verify that your provider's toolset matches your project type and that they can export to your FM platform of choice.

What is ISO 19650 and do Indian BIM providers comply with it?
ISO 19650 is the international standard for managing information over the whole life cycle of a built asset using BIM — it defines how information should be structured, named, shared, and verified at each project stage. It is mandatory for UK government projects and increasingly required by international developers, APAC hyperscale operators, and global financial institutions.
